The TW9990-BATB-GR is a high-performance analog video decoder designed by Intersil. It is engineered to convert standard analog baseband television signals, including NTSC, PAL, and SECAM, into digital video formats. This decoder integrates several advanced features, such as a 3D comb filter for superior color separation and noise reduction, as well as automatic gain control (AGC) and automatic white balance (AWB) for optimal image quality under varying conditions.
Applications
- Automotive infotainment systems
- Surveillance cameras and digital video recorders (DVRs)
- Rear-view camera systems
- Portable media players
- Video capture cards
Features
- Multi-standard analog video decoding (NTSC, PAL, SECAM)
- 3D comb filter for enhanced color separation and noise reduction
- Automatic gain control (AGC) and automatic white balance (AWB)
- Adaptive contrast enhancement (ACE)
- 10-bit analog-to-digital converters (ADCs)
- YCbCr 4:2:2 output format
- I2C interface for control and configuration
- Low power consumption

Additional Details
The TW9990-BATB-GR operates from a single 3.3V power supply. The adaptive contrast enhancement (ACE) feature dynamically adjusts the contrast of the image to improve visibility in both bright and dark areas. The 10-bit ADCs provide high-resolution conversion of the analog video signal, resulting in accurate color reproduction. The device is designed to meet the demanding requirements of automotive and surveillance applications. The I2C interface allows for easy configuration and control of various parameters, enabling fine-tuning of the video output.
